A vulnerability in Nuvation Energy nCloud VPN Service allowed Network Boundary Bridging.This issue affected the nCloud VPN Service and was fixed on 2025-12-1 (December, 2025). End users do not have to take any action to mitigate the issue.
The vulnerability classified as CWE-441 (Unintended Proxy or Intermediary) occurred because the VPN service acted as an unintended intermediary enabling traffic between network segments that should have been isolated from each other. As a result, an attacker with access to one network segment could potentially reach resources in segments that should have been inaccessible. The attack vector is network-based, does not require sophisticated conditions, and successful exploitation can impact both target systems and external infrastructure.
An attacker can gain unauthorized access to resources in isolated network segments, which in industrial or critical environments may lead to violations of confidentiality, integrity, and availability of OT/IT systems.
A patch was deployed by the vendor on December 1, 2025. The vendor informs that end users do not need to take any additional actions to remediate the vulnerability — the fix was implemented on the service side.
Nuvation Energy nCloud VPN Service — versions released before 2025-12-01 (December 2025)
